Abstract
Wide band dielectric spectroscopy has been used to study the bulk dynamics of the simple supercooled liquid m-toluidine. Following the temperature and frequency dependence of the dielectric response we find a stretched relaxa tion process, the stretching parameter of which is temperature dependent. T he observed decoupling between rotational and translational diffusion param eters at low temperatures may be the result of heterogeneous dynamics. (C) 2001 American Institute of Physics.
